Explanation: The full meaning of ADHD is attention-deficit/ hyperactive disorder. It is believed that ADHD is genetic. It is a chronic behavioural disorder that is diagnosed in childhood and can continue into adulthood. Children diagnosed with this disorder experience difficulty with paying attention, sitting still, they fidget, they are hyperactive and easily distracted. We have 3 types of ADHD, they are:
a) ADHD the combined type
b) ADHD the Hyperactive -type
C) ADHD the inattentive and distractible type.
